#033bb2 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#033bb2 is composed of 1.2% red, 23.1%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.3% cyan, 66.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 220.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 35.5%. #033bb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#0676ff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

● #033bb2 color description : D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#033bb2 has RGB values of R:3, G:59,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 211890.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000104 is the darkest color, while #f0f5ff is the lightest one.
